52 Skillz with Stephen Robinson // Edmonton Portraits

52 Skillz with Stephen Robinson // Edmonton Portraits

I had a chance to work with Stephen Robinson who is the creator of  the series called “52 Skillz”. It is the undertaking of an individual where Stephen decided he wanted to learn 52 Different Skillz across 52 weeks and boy has it been a journey. I met Stephen Robinson in eHub at the University of Alberta while he was working on some ideas for his new skill.

He is an extraordinary individual who taught me to challenge myself to learn something new everyday. In his quest to develop a new skill every week, he has been able to demonstrate the ability of humans to adapt and learn at an incredible pace.

His final project was to combine all of the 52 skillz he learnt during the year to make a huge Rube Goldberg Machine. I got a chance to see the machine in action and it was very impressive. Here is the video of the machine in action:

Lisa Marie Couture – Mistress of the Storm

Lisa Marie Couture – Mistress of the Storm – Edmonton Portrait Photographer

“Mistress of the Storm” comes from the book by Melanie Walsh. It goes over the journey of a boat and its crew through a storm as the name implies. That gave me the inspiration to create this portrait concept.

There is nothing quite like taking an environmental portrait with an excellent team working with you. This was such an opportunity. Wizard lake provided us with the perfect blend of water and storm to create this amazing imagery. Environmental portraits represent some of the most challenging portraits that can be achieved as they are meant as a mix of both the subject and the environment in a complex manner that is not only complementary but almost symbiotic.

I collaborated with Lisa Marie couture to product this concept that I call “Mistress of the Storm”. Lisa Marie is a dress designer who makes these fabulous dresses for her clients (Brides).

In order to create this images Yara Sayegh assisted me! She helped us get setup for the shoot and then followed up with providing logistic support by making sure that my equipment didn’t blow away due to the severe storm prevalent at that time. For that I am grateful!

Rizwan the Comedian // Professional Headshots Edmonton

Professional Headshots Edmonton

The professional headshot (also known as head shot)is one of the most recognized and well known type of photograph. It has been a classic tool for marketing yourself in the entertainment industry. It is often used by actors, models and other similar professionals to market themselves. They are also used by other professionals such as lawyers, dentists, doctors etc for their websites and other marketing materials.
